Festive Christmas Cheese Ball Recipe: Your Ultimate Holiday Appetizer

October 22, 2025 by Carlos Hernandez

A festive Christmas cheese ball log, coated in nuts and cranberries, with a rosemary sprig, served with crackers.

Table of Contents

Welcome to the most wonderful time of the year! Holiday entertaining doesn’t have to be stressful when you have a delicious, easy-to-make appetizer ready to go. Today, we’re sharing a recipe for a classic Christmas cheese ball that will be the star of your festive spread. This savory delight is simple to prepare, can be made ahead, and brings all the festive cheer to your gatherings.

Why You’ll Love This Christmas Cheese Ball

This delightful appetizer is a holiday favorite for so many reasons. You will adore making and serving this impressive yet effortless dish.

  • Quick and easy to prepare. In just a few simple steps, you’ll have a gourmet-looking appetizer ready for any party.
  • Simple, accessible ingredients. You likely have most of the items on hand, making this a budget-friendly option.
  • Perfect make-ahead appetizer. Prepare your Christmas cheese ball days in advance, freeing up time on the big day.
  • Festive flavor and appearance. The combination of cranberries and pecans creates a beautiful, holiday-ready look and taste.
  • Customizable for any taste. Easily adjust the ingredients to suit different preferences or dietary needs.
  • Always a crowd-pleaser. This savory and creamy dip is universally loved and disappears quickly at any gathering.

Ingredients

Gather these simple items for your delicious Christmas cheese ball. Fresh, quality ingredients always make a difference.

  • 8 oz. Cream Cheese: Softened to room temperature. Use full-fat brick-style for the best creamy texture.
  • 8 oz. Sharp Cheddar Cheese: Freshly grated for superior flavor and melt.
  • 1 teaspoon Garlic: Finely minced, offering an aromatic base.
  • 2 teaspoons Grated Onion: Adds a subtle, savory bite without being overpowering.
  • 2 teaspoons Worcestershire Sauce: Delivers a crucial umami depth. According to culinary resources, Worcestershire sauce is known for its complex umami flavor, which adds a savory and meaty depth to dishes.
  • 1/2 cup Pecans: Finely chopped, perfect for the crunchy exterior.
  • 1/4 cup Dried Cranberries: Chopped, for festive color and a sweet-tart burst.

Notes & Substitutions

You can easily adapt this recipe to fit your pantry or personal preferences. Here are some helpful tips for your festive cheese ball.

  • Cream Cheese: Always use brick-style cream cheese, not the whipped or spreadable kind, for proper consistency.
  • Cheese: Feel free to experiment with other hard cheeses like Colby Jack, white cheddar, or a Monterey Jack blend.
  • Aromatics: If you don’t have fresh, use 1/2 teaspoon garlic powder and 1 teaspoon onion powder.
  • Worcestershire: For a gluten-free or vegetarian option, use coconut aminos or a dash of soy sauce.
  • Pecans: Walnuts, almonds, or even cashews work wonderfully for the crunchy coating.
  • Cranberries: Swap in dried cherries, apricots, or even pomegranate arils for varied color and flavor.

Equipment

You won’t need many special tools to create this fantastic appetizer. Most of these are common kitchen staples.

  • Large mixing bowl
  • Electric hand mixer or stand mixer (optional, but helpful)
  • Box grater or food processor
  • Rubber spatula
  • Plastic wrap or parchment paper
  • Serving platter

Instructions

Creating your perfect Christmas cheese ball is straightforward and fun. Follow these simple steps for a holiday favorite.

First, ensure your cream cheese is completely softened to room temperature. This is crucial for a smooth mixture, so set it out on the counter at least an hour beforehand. Next, finely grate your sharp cheddar cheese using a box grater or a food processor attachment. Freshly grated cheese melts and blends much better than pre-shredded varieties. Then, finely mince the garlic and grate the onion. A microplane works well for the garlic, and a small grater for the onion.

In a large mixing bowl, combine the softened cream cheese, grated cheddar, minced garlic, grated onion, and Worcestershire sauce. Use a rubber spatula to scrape down the sides of the bowl. Beat these ingredients together until they are well combined and smooth. If you are using an electric hand mixer, start on low speed to prevent splattering, then increase to medium. Make sure there are no lumps of cream cheese.

Now, prepare the exterior coating for your Christmas cheese ball. Finely chop the pecans and dried cranberries. You want them small enough to adhere well to the cheese ball. Spread the chopped nuts and cranberries evenly on a large sheet of parchment paper or plastic wrap.

Transfer the prepared cheese mixture from the bowl onto the center of the parchment paper with the toppings. Using the parchment paper to assist you, gently shape the mixture into a firm ball or a log shape. Roll the cheese in the chopped pecans and cranberries, pressing gently to ensure an consistent and thorough coating on all sides.

Wrap the formed cheese ball tightly in plastic wrap. Refrigerate it for at least 2 hours, or ideally overnight. This chilling time allows the flavors to meld beautifully and ensures the cheese ball is firm enough to hold its shape when served. Before serving, let your Christmas cheese ball sit at room temperature for 30-45 minutes. This softens it slightly, making it much easier to spread and enjoy.

Pro Tips for the Best Christmas Cheese Ball

Achieve an even more delicious and visually appealing cheese ball with these expert tips. Simple adjustments make a big difference.

  • Room Temperature Cream Cheese: This is non-negotiable! Cold cream cheese will result in a lumpy mixture. Allow it to soften fully.
  • Freshly Grated Cheese: Always grate your own cheddar. Pre-shredded cheeses often contain anti-caking agents that affect texture.
  • Chill Thoroughly: Don’t skip the chilling step. It’s essential for the flavors to meld and for a firm, shapely Christmas cheese ball.
  • Finely Chop Toppings: Ensure your nuts and cranberries are finely chopped. This helps them adhere better and distribute evenly.
  • Serve at Right Temperature: Allowing the cheese ball to sit out for a bit makes it softer and easier for your guests to spread.
  • Season to Taste: After mixing, taste a tiny bit of the cheese mixture. Adjust salt, pepper, or Worcestershire sauce as needed.
  • Presentation Matters: Garnish your serving platter with fresh rosemary sprigs and a few whole cranberries for an extra festive touch.

Serving, Storage, & Variations

Make the most of your festive appetizer with these helpful suggestions. From presentation to creative twists, we’ve got you covered.

Serving Suggestions

A beautiful Christmas cheese ball deserves an equally appealing display. Offer a variety of accompaniments.

  • Assorted crackers such as buttery Ritz, savory wheat thins, or elegant water crackers.
  • Toasted baguette slices or crisp crostini provide a sturdy base.
  • Pretzel crisps or pita chips offer a different kind of crunch.
  • Fresh vegetable sticks like celery, carrots, and colorful bell peppers for a lighter option.
  • Garnish the platter with fresh rosemary sprigs and whole cranberries for an extra festive touch.

Storage Instructions

This make-ahead friendly appetizer stores wonderfully, perfect for holiday planning.

For those planning ahead, consider general food safety guidelines for make-ahead appetizers to ensure your dish remains delicious and safe for consumption.

  • Refrigerate: Store your prepared Christmas cheese ball wrapped tightly in plastic wrap in the refrigerator for up to 5-7 days.
  • Freeze: For longer storage, wrap the cheese ball twice in plastic wrap, then an additional layer of aluminum foil. Freeze for up to 1 month.
  • Thawing: Thaw frozen cheese balls in the refrigerator overnight before serving.
  • Re-rolling: After thawing, if the topping looks sparse, you can gently re-roll it in a fresh batch of chopped pecans and cranberries.

Flavor Variations

Get creative with your Christmas cheese ball by trying these exciting flavor combinations!

  • Sweet & Savory: Add a tablespoon of brown sugar to the mix, and use candied pecans with diced apples.
  • Spicy Kick: Mix in finely diced jalapeños (seeds removed for less heat) or a pinch of red pepper flakes.
  • Herby Fresh: Incorporate fresh chopped chives, parsley, dill, or thyme into the cheese mixture.
  • Mediterranean: Add sun-dried tomatoes (oil drained), chopped black olives, and a touch of crumbled feta cheese.
  • Bacon Ranch: Fold in crumbled cooked bacon bits and a tablespoon of dry ranch seasoning mix.
  • Everything Bagel: Coat the cheese ball entirely with everything bagel seasoning and mix in finely chopped scallions.

Nutrition Information

Please remember that all nutrition information is an estimate. It can vary based on specific brands and quantities of ingredients used. This table provides a general guide for your festive dish.

NutrientAmount
Serving Size1 ounce
Calories276 kcal
Carbohydrate Content8 g
Protein Content9 g
Fat Content24 g
Saturated Fat Content11 g
Cholesterol Content57 mg
Sodium Content288 mg
Fiber Content1 g
Sugar Content5 g
Unsaturated Fat Content10 g

Frequently Asked Questions (FAQ)

We’ve answered some common questions about making this delicious holiday appetizer.

  • Can I make this Christmas cheese ball ahead of time? Absolutely! You can prepare and refrigerate it for 5-7 days in advance.
  • What kind of cheese works best? A cream cheese base combined with sharp cheddar cheese offers the best flavor and texture.
  • How do I shape the cheese ball without it sticking to my hands? Use plastic wrap or parchment paper to help you form the ball cleanly and easily.
  • Can I freeze leftover Christmas cheese ball? Yes, you can freeze it for up to 1 month. Just remember to thaw it in the refrigerator overnight.
  • What should I serve with a Christmas cheese ball? Classic pairings include various crackers, toasted baguette slices, or fresh vegetable sticks.
  • Can I omit the onion or garlic? You can definitely adjust these aromatics to your taste, or substitute with their powdered forms if you prefer.

Conclusion

This Festive Christmas Cheese Ball recipe is truly the ultimate holiday appetizer. It’s incredibly easy to make, beautifully festive, and always a delicious hit with guests. This make-ahead friendly dish will simplify your holiday entertaining and bring joy to any gathering. We encourage you to try this simple recipe and make it a staple at your festive celebrations. Share your creations and let us know what you think in the comments below!

Festive Christmas Cheese Ball Recipe: Your Ultimate Holiday Appetizer

This festive Christmas Cheese Ball is the perfect holiday appetizer, combining softened cream cheese and sharp cheddar with a hint of garlic and Worcestershire sauce, then coated in chopped pecans and dried cranberries for a delightful seasonal treat.
Prep Time 15 minutes
Total Time 15 minutes
Servings 10 servings
Calories 220 kcal

Equipment

  • Mixing Bowl

Ingredients
  

Main Ingredients

  • 8 oz Cream Cheese softened
  • 8 oz Sharp Cheddar Cheese grated
  • 1 teaspoon Garlic finely minced
  • 2 teaspoons Grated Onion
  • 2 teaspoons Worcestershire Sauce
  • 1/2 cup Pecans chopped
  • 1/4 cup Dried Cranberries chopped

Instructions
 

Preparation

  • Combine all ingredients, except the pecans and cranberries, in a mixing bowl then shape into a ball.
  • Coat the shaped cheese ball evenly with the chopped pecans and dried cranberries.
  • Serve immediately with crackers, chips, or toasted bread. If made ahead, refrigerate and allow to come to room temperature (about 45 minutes) before serving for best results.

Notes

For optimal taste and texture, remember to allow the cheese ball to sit at room temperature for approximately 45 minutes before serving if it has been refrigerated.

Printable Recipe Card

Want just the essential recipe details without scrolling through the article? Get our printable recipe card with just the ingredients and instructions.

Readers Love These Recipes

Leave a Comment

Recipe Rating